Bad news struck the New York Yankees, who are challenging the MLB World Series for the first time in 14 years. ‘Main gun’ Aaron Judge (31) left due to injury. It was the moment when the nightmare of three years ago came back to mind.
MLB.com, the official homepage of the Major League Baseball, reported on the 2nd (Korean time) that “Judge was placed on the 10-day injured list (IL) due to right hip pain.” Registration was applied retroactively from the 29th of last month.
Judge suffered a hip injury while sliding during a game against the Texas Rangers on the 27th of last month. He was named to the starting lineup for the next day’s game, but went 2-for-2 with only 2 strikeouts, and was removed from the game in the bottom of the 4th inning when he was substituted for a major defense.
According to MLB.com, Aaron Boone, manager of the Yankees, said, “It’s not a major injury, but I don’t want to continue to play and make it worse or affect other areas,” he explained why he enrolled in the IL. He went on to say, “I feel good, I’m still recovering.” According to the media, Judge digested his catch ball indoors while warming up on this day.
Judge has played in 26 games this season and has a batting average of 0.261, 6 home runs, 14 RBIs, and an OPS of 0.863. He is not up to his flashy last season (batting average of 0.311, 62 home runs, 131 RBI), but in the game on the 27th of last month, he was raising his sense of hitting with 3 hits, including 2 doubles.
At one time, Judge had a headache due to an injury. He played in 155 of 162 games in 2017, but the number of games gradually decreased to 112 games the following year and 102 games in 2019 due to oblique muscle and wrist injuries. Even in the 60-game shortened season due to Corona 19 in 2020, he only played 28 games, less than half of them.
In particular, the Yankees had difficulty operating the ‘double guns’ as Giancarlo Stanton (34), who forms a duo with Judge, also suffered frequent injuries. Since 2018, when Stanton moved to the Yankees, the two players have not played more than 140 games side-by-side. Stanton and Judge are both giants who have hit more than 50 home runs. At the time Stanton joined the Yankees, prospects were pouring in that the synergy between the two players would explode, but due to injuries, they were struggling to hit 30 home runs side by side after 2021.
Despite repeated injuries, Stanton, who hit 30 homers in both seasons, came to the IL in mid-April of this year after suffering a hamstring injury. With Judge joining here, the Yankees faced obstacles in their first World Series championship challenge since 2009.
